There's so little of it. One day for your first year (!!!), and you don't accrue up to 2 weeks until you've worked with target for FIVE YEARS.

You accrue it, but you aren't always able to use it. You need to plan it out in advance to make sure it's approved and you basically can't take vacation from mid October until January in stores if your a leader
